Quick Answer

Lake County, OH: 1.96% effective rate · $4,507/yr median tax · median home $229,963

Multnomah County, OR: 0.78% effective rate · $3,139/yr median tax · median home $402,455

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Lake County and Multnomah County?
Lake County, OH has an effective property tax rate of 1.96% with a median annual tax of $4,507. Multnomah County, OR has a rate of 0.78% with a median annual tax of $3,139. The difference is 1.18 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Lake County or Multnomah County?
Lake County, OH has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.96% compared to 0.78%.
How do Lake County and Multnomah County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Lake County is above average at 1.96%, and Multnomah County is below average at 0.78%.
